Job Purpose and Impact
The Director of Procurement for Parts and Equipment will lead procurement activities across the North American region. This role provides strategic and operational leadership to drive disciplined execution of category strategies across Cargill. You will build and inspire a high‑performing team, lead change where needed, and oversee end‑to‑end sourcing activities to deliver measurable business value and outcomes.
Key Accountabilities
- Provide strategic leadership and oversight of the sourcing process, ensuring the Parts and Equipment Team is aligned with enterprise, business, and procurement objectives.
- Drive value creation through data and metrics by setting clear goals, strengthening supplier agreements and relationships, and advancing team capabilities and expertise.
- Support established process initiatives and identify opportunities for improvement and value creation, fostering an engaging culture of continuous improvement and operational excellence.
- Align team resources to deliver short and long‑term strategies and achieve Procurement and Business objectives. Build and maintain strong relationships with regional business stakeholders anticipating needs and enabling strategic outcomes.
- Lead collaboration with internal and external partners, participating cross‑functionally to identify and advance opportunities within the Parts and Equipment category.
- Apply procurement and leadership experience, plus an understanding of regional markets and spend to advise and influence decision making.
- Ensure accountability for performance targets and expense management.
- Lead and develop a team of professionals, including responsibility for hiring, performance management, coaching, and disciplinary actions.
- Partner with peers to ensure talent decisions align with current and future organizational needs.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
Qualifications
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
- Bachelor’s degree in a related field OR equivalent experience
- Minimum of six years of related work experience
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
- Three or more years of supervisory experience
- Previous experience in Procurement, Maintenance and Reliability, Engineering or other Manufacturing operations experience
- Experience in Parts or Equipment Procurement
Compensation Data
The expected salary for this position is $140,000-$180,000. Compensation varies depending on a wide array of factors including but not limited to the specific location, certifications, education, and level of experience. The disclosed range estimate may be adjusted for any applicable geographic differential associated with the location at which the position may be filled. This position is eligible for a discretionary incentive award. The incentive award amount is dependent upon company performance and your personal performance.
